After an unusually lengthy international break early in the new season, Liverpool, under the guidance of Jürgen Klopp, is set to return to the pitch with a Saturday kick-off against Wolves. This fixture could potentially mark the debut of Ryan Gravenberch, who joined the team on transfer deadline day. Although he missed the opportunity to feature against Aston Villa due to registration issues, Gravenberch is now eligible for selection. However, stiff competition exists in the midfield, with Dominik Szoboszlai, Curtis Jones, Harvey Elliott, and Alexis Mac Allister all vying for roles in the number eight position. Additionally, Liverpool fans hoping to see Gravenberch as a defensive midfielder face competition from Wataru Endō and Stefan Bajčetić, with Thiago set to challenge in both categories once fully fit.
Despite this fierce midfield competition, Liverpool is still reportedly exploring the possibility of adding another midfielder to their ranks. However, they are not alone in their interest, as Barcelona and other clubs are also in the mix. One of the transfer targets that both Liverpool and Barcelona are said to be eyeing is the 18-year-old Belgian sensation, Arthur Vermeeren. According to Mundo Deportivo, Vermeeren, who plays as a deep-lying midfielder for Royal Antwerp, has drawn interest from both clubs. Notably, he is set to visit the Nou Camp as an opponent in the Champions League next week, adding further intrigue to this potential transfer saga.
